"I would never have left Hendrix if it hadn't been for Richi." This is what the current German champion announces with a smile right at the beginning of our interview.


Richi" of course means her boyfriend, Richard Vogel. The two have already been a couple for 4 years. How did they get to know each other? "Through riding, of course!" laughs Hinners. At the beginning of their relationship, the two had a long-distance relationship. Sophie was employed at the Hendrix family's stable in the Netherlands, whereas Richard was still riding in Riesenbeck at Ludger Beerbaum's stable at the time. When asked how such a long-distance relationship is managed, Sophie says: "Of course, it's not always easy. We always tried - when one of us had time off - to visit each other or to book a vacation together. Sometimes we also had tournaments together. And of course a lot of FaceTimen. That makes things a lot easier!"

After Richard teamed up with David Will together in Dagobertshausen, it was slowly becoming clear to Sophie that a change was coming. "Richi and I have been together for four years now. Because of the distance, we have of course not seen each other as often as would be the case now, for example, with normal couples. At some point, I thought to myself, you have to find out now sometime, whether this really fits. And then I took the plunge."


The 23-year-old knew that such a decision also involves many risks. "Of course, there was also a risk involved in leaving such a stable as Hendrix. To be honest, I had prepared myself at the beginning to really only ride young show jumpers and then to have to work my way up again. I would never have expected that it would turn out like this," Hinners says, beaming.


The amazon almost has a family relationship with the Hendrix family. After a long collaboration and many international successes later, she is very grateful to the family. "I really owe so much to the entire Hendrix team. Together with them, I was able to collect my first world ranking points and have been able to celebrate so many great successes."


For Hinners, it was initially unclear whether she would be able to continue riding her top horse, Vittorio. But for Emil Hendrix, her former boss, it was a matter of course. Sophie is incredibly grateful to him.


At the beginning of Sophie's riding career, a career in the dressage saddle was actually more apparent. She herself rode dressage up to elementary level. But since she only took over jumping ponies from her cousin, she then switched to the jumping saddle. Here she also found her great passion.

To this day, Sophie is one of the best U25 riders in Europe. In training, she places very special emphasis on dressage work. "If the basics in dressage work already don't work, how are you supposed to be able to implement that in the course?", the 24-year-old concludes. She always alternates between row-jumping, outside canter and travers.


Together with her partner, she is always on the lookout for young talent. "We definitely pay attention to character. For example, we always try to be present at a trial when the horse is getting ready, so that we can get an overall picture of the horse. At the jump, of course, we look at the quality and how the horse takes off. Thank goodness we often have the right nose."


In the future, Sophie would like to establish herself further in international sport together with her partners Richard Vogel and David Will and hopes for good results.
